Well, evidently you missed the "deep theme" all together. The "deep theme" in Ringworld pertained to the Puppeteer's implementation of the birthright lotteries to produce a "lucky" human. Teela Brown was one of those "lucky" humans. Her "luck" conducted the entire excursion to the Ringworld, because her going to the Ringworld was in her own best interests. It turned out that she went to the Ringworld to meet the man she was predestined to love, under the pretense of being Luis Wu's companion.

You mention a recurrent theme of over-population. This is not entirely true, you mention it in the human context which is not how it is presented in the book. In the book over-population is an issue with the Puppeteers, not the humans. The Puppeteers were running out of room on the Kemplerer Rosette of worlds that they occupy. They moved this set of moonless planets (read Larry Niven's book called The Crashlander, a book of short stories about Beowulf Schafer, for the story on why they don't have any moons) out of human space towards the Greater Magellanic Cloud. This was after Beowulf Schafer traveled to the center of the Galaxy and back in the Longshot, long before it ever went to the Ringworld. Beowulf discovered that the Galaxy's core was reaching critical mass, and would explode. Imagine a galactic sized supernova. The Puppeteers were interested in the Ringworld, not only for it's size (6 X 10 to the 6th square miles) But because scrith, the material the Ringworld is made of, would halt 40% of the neutrino burst that would be created when the Galactic core goes nova. The Puppeteers main priority was the protection of their species. They were renowned for their cowardice, a cowardice that was only a physcological evolution of the simple act of turning their back on an enemy, the true nature of that reaction was so they could free up their hind foot for battle.
